A major company in a manufacturing industry is looking for a FP&A Analyst.
Job Title: FP&A Analyst
Location: Montreal
A manufacturing company
Salary: 80-95k depending on experience with boni
Duration: 12 months/permanent
40 hours\week

Responsibilities
- Prepare annual budgeting and forecasting
- Perform financial reporting
- Analyze performance and develop dasboards
- Assist with month-end tasks
- Other ad-hoc duties
Qualifications
- CPA, CPA in progress, CFA (ian asset)
- Bilingual
- 2+ years experience in finance accounting
- Strong excel, Power BI (an asset)
- To be located in Montreal
